Core Viewpoint - Greenwave Technology Solutions, Inc. is positioned to benefit significantly from anticipated copper tariffs announced by President Trump, which could lead to increased revenue due to its provision of 100% domestically-sourced recycled metals to major industry players [1][2]. Group 1: Company Overview - Greenwave operates 13 metal recycling facilities and supplies leading steel mills and industrial partners with 100% domestically-sourced metals [4]. - The company is headquartered in Chesapeake, Virginia, and plays a critical role in infrastructure projects and U.S. national security [4]. Group 2: Financial Outlook - Greenwave has raised its revenue guidance for Fiscal Year 2025 to between $47 million and $50 million [1]. - The company anticipates surging demand and expanding profit margins throughout Fiscal Year 2025 due to the shift in the U.S. steel and metals industry towards domestic sourcing [3]. Group 3: Market Position - Greenwave is recognized as one of the dominant suppliers of mill-ready shred and other recycled metals in the Mid-Atlantic region [3]. - Its strategic locations in Virginia, North Carolina, and Ohio position the company at the center of significant industry dynamics [3].
